Last updated: July 2026 dataUrea ammonium nitrate solution (UAN) is a liquid nitrogen fertilizer — typically 28%, 30%, or 32% nitrogen — that is one of the most widely applied nitrogen sources in US row-crop agriculture, used for pre-plant, side-dress, and fertigation applications. Classified under 3102800000, US imports arrive predominantly from Russia and Trinidad and Tobago, with Canada and the Netherlands also supplying the market. Russian-origin UAN has been subject to antidumping and countervailing duty orders, making origin verification and AD/CVD deposit calculations a routine compliance step for importers. The liquid form requires specialized tanker vessels and terminal infrastructure, concentrating import activity at Gulf Coast and inland river terminals.

Yes, antidumping and countervailing duty orders have been imposed on UAN solution from Russia, and orders have also covered other origins at various times. Importers must check the current scope of active orders with CBP or the International Trade Commission before entry, as AD/CVD cash deposits are required at time of importation and can significantly affect landed cost.
UAN solution must be transported in corrosion-resistant liquid tankers or barges and stored in dedicated liquid fertilizer tanks at import terminals. This limits viable entry points to ports with liquid fertilizer terminal capacity — primarily Gulf Coast and Mississippi River facilities — and requires coordination between vessel operators, terminal operators, and inland transport providers well in advance of the application season.
